The PBR World Cup Final is almost here. Tomorrow night every team captain will have to put his money where his mouth is. The past few weeks have seemed more like episodes of All My Children than the PBR. What started out as a great concept has gotten more and more personal. But make no mistake, while it has often appeared as if the act of bull riding has taken a back seat to a bit of politicking, we will be treated to some good bull rides.

Let’s have a quick look at the final teams. For the United States, Team Captain J.W. Hart has selected Ryan McConnel, McKennon Wimberly, Mike Lee, Austin Meier, and Travis Briscoe. An interesting team, and a good one, I feel. Yes, noticeably absent is J.B. Mauney, whose riding has taken a severe dump. Two months ago he was on top of the BFTS standings. Now he is in sixth place, and while he is not that far behind, back in February he looked to be almost unstoppable. Now is struggling to make that eight-second ride.

Adriano Moraes has put together a strong team for Brazil as well. He has Guilherme Marchi, Robson Palermo, Silvano Alves, who has been looking sharp as can be in his BFTS appearances, a rider we are not familiar with, Paulo Ferreira, and Renato Nunes, the man that had much controversy swirling around him as to whether or not he would actually be named to be on the Brazilian team. Also need to note here that Valdiron de Oliveira was named to the team, but had to be replaced when he was injured.

Team Canada is headed up by Cody Snyder. His team consists of Tanner Girletz, Aaron Roy, Scott Schiffner, Tyler Thompson, Devon Mezei, and Vince Northrop.

As is Hart, Moraes, and Snyder, Troy Dunn is once again Team Captain for Australia. His team has the Farley brothers, Pete and Jared, Ben Jones, David Kennedy, Brendon Clark, and Jason O’Hearn.

Finally, Team Mexico. Led by Gerardo Venegas, with co-captains Amando Aguirre and Ruben Mujica, their team members are Rocky McDonald, Nile LeBaron, Francisco Morales, Lorenozo Rios, and Gustavo Pedrero.

We will get to see 50 cowboys and bulls do their thing each performance, and I am looking forward to a great weekend. Each team will be doing their best to be the World Cup Champion come Sunday afternoon. Brazil won the first World Cup, held in Queensland, Australia in 2007. The United States won the next two, which were held in Chihuahua, Mexico, and Sao Paulo, Brazil. Defeated in their home country, Brazil now wants a bit of payback. Mexico, Australia, and Canada all want to prove they are the force to be reckoned with as well. But our home team has other ideas.

Who will actually take home the gold remains to be seen. But I hope that everyone enjoys the World Cup Final – I know that I will!
